
--replicate-rewrite-db 옵션은 MySQL 복제에서 데이터베이스 이름을 변경하거나 바꾸는 경우에 사용됩니다. 이 옵션을 사용하여 원본 데이터베이스 이름과 복제 데이터베이스 이름이 다를 때 복제가 가능합니다.
예를 들어, 원본 데이터베이스 이름이 "원본"이고 복제 데이터베이스 이름이 "복제"인 경우, --replicate-rewrite-db 옵션을 사용하여 복제할 수 있습니다.
#hostingforum.kr
sql
--replicate-rewrite-db=원본->복제
이 옵션을 사용하면, 원본 데이터베이스 이름이 "원본"인 경우, 복제 데이터베이스 이름이 "복제"로 변경됩니다.
이러한 옵션을 사용하여, 데이터베이스 이름을 변경하거나 바꾸는 경우에 복제가 가능합니다.
이 옵션을 사용할 때 발생할 수 있는 문제는, 복제 데이터베이스 이름이 변경된 후에 원본 데이터베이스와 복제 데이터베이스 간의 일관성이 유지되지 않는다는 것입니다. 따라서, 데이터베이스 이름을 변경할 때는 반드시 테이블 이름, 칼럼 이름, 인덱스 이름 등과 같은 다른 이름을 변경해야 합니다.
이 옵션을 사용할 때의 장점은, 데이터베이스 이름을 변경하거나 바꾸는 경우에 복제가 가능하다는 것입니다. 또한, 데이터베이스 이름을 변경할 때는 원본 데이터베이스와 복제 데이터베이스 간의 일관성을 유지할 수 있습니다.
예를 들어, 원본 데이터베이스 이름이 "원본"이고 복제 데이터베이스 이름이 "복제"인 경우, --replicate-rewrite-db 옵션을 사용하여 복제할 수 있습니다.
#hostingforum.kr
sql
--replicate-rewrite-db=원본->복제
이 옵션을 사용하면, 원본 데이터베이스 이름이 "원본"인 경우, 복제 데이터베이스 이름이 "복제"로 변경됩니다.
이러한 옵션을 사용하여, 데이터베이스 이름을 변경하거나 바꾸는 경우에 복제가 가능합니다.
2025-03-20 04:21